—Dietz on Science— U. $, SCIENTIST DEALS EINSTEIN: THEORY BLOW Precipitates Storm After Experiments on Solar Motion. BY DAVID DIETZ, Reripps-Hnward Science Editor WASHINGTON, April 29.—A new storm over the validity of the Einstein theory of relativity started recently when Dr. Dayton C. Miller, world-famous physicfst of Cleveland, told the National Academy of Sciences in session here that after forty years of work he had at last succeeded in measuring the absolute motion of the earth around the sun. An international discussion is certain to follow, for his statement constitutes the most serious blow ever aimed at the theory of relativity. Professor Einstein’s theory holds no experiment is possible which will detect the absolute motion of the earth. If scientists accept Dr. Miller’s findings, they will have to modify profoundly the very foundations upon which relativity rests. The Einstein theory grew out of an experiment originally performed in Cleveland in 1887 by Dr. A. A. Michelson and Dr Edward W. Moriey. This experiment, known to science as the Michelson-Morley experiment, was an attempt to measure the absolute motion of the earth through the ether of space. Observes Light Beam The experiment did not give the desired result, and the scientific world in general took the stand that it had given a negative result. It was on this basis that Professor Einstein built his theory of relativity. But Dr. Miller, who succeeded Dr. Michelson as professor of physics at Case School in Cleveland, was unwilling to accept that interpretation, and ever since 1890 he has been continuing the experiment in the belief that it eventually would demonstrate the motion of the earth around the sun. In 1925 and 1926, Dr. Miller set up his interferometer on Mt. Wilson in California. The interferometer consists of a great horizontal steel cross with arms sixteen feet long, floating on a pool of mercury. Observations of a beam of light are made through a telescope as the cross revolves. Awarded Annual Prize During the two years. Dr. Miller made more than 200,000 observations on the interferometer. This meant that he walked a total of more than 250 miles around the revolving interferometer. In 1926, he announced his measurements demonstrated that the earth and the whole solar system was moving through space with a velocity of about 120 miles a second. The American Association for the Advancement of Science regarded his work of such importance that it awarded him its annual prize of SI,OOO that year for the outstanding contribution to science of the year. Advocates of the theory of relativity, however, were unwilling to accept his result since nothing was said about the motion of the earth around the sun. Proves Ether's Existence They felt that even though there was a motion of the solar system through space, the experiment ought to show also the motion of the earth around the sun, providing that Professor Einstein was wrong in his fundamental assumption. Last year. Dr. Miller began a complete new analysis of the 200,000 observations which he had made at Mt. Wilson. This time he assumed that the solar system was moving toward the constellation of Hercules with a speed of twelve miles per second, , as other astronomical observations indicated, but that the entire galaxy including our solar system, the constellation of Hercules and all the other constellations of the MilkyWay were moving in the opposite direction with a velocity of 120 miles per second. Asa result. Dr. Miller claims to have demonstrated the motion of the earth around the sun, to have demonstrated the motion of the solar system through space, and to have demonstrated the existence n f the ether of space.
